Fabric and glitter

I am trying to find out, how to get (a little) glitter on parts of my fabric. I have made a pumkin and just want a little glitter on it. Can any one tell me what kind of glue and glitter to get and how to use it? Thank you so much. What I have I find it going on to thick.

They make a glitter glue that's all in one, all kinds of colors, and easy to use....you can use a good all-purpose glue (not water soluble)P, that dries clear, such as Aileen's...Place a thin layer of the glue down in the area you want to embellish, then sprinkle your loose glitter over the glued area, let it dry.......Check at your local craft store, the clerks should be able to help find a method that works best for what you are wanting to do...........Here in Florida, we have Joann's, Hobby Lobby or Michael's, to name a few major stores........Not sure if they are in Montana or not, but I'd be willing to bet you have something comparable....Post your pics when it's finished.....

I would use like a glue stick, that way you could be very precise as to where it goes...and or, put a glob of glue on wax papter and use a little paint brush....and then just sprinkle glitter on....

I've used iridescent paint with the writing tube from the craft dep't by putting it on a paper towel and using a small paintbrush, or you can green glitter paint on the greens, orange on the orange, etc. I can't remember the name - we used to use it on sweatshirts and leave it dimensional. Oh, Scribbles by Duncan was one brand.
